In reply to my original posting:-

After a week of cooler, wet weather here in the UK, I logged in to the
server, ran escputil again with the nozzle check option, and it looks
almost perfect today. IMHO it's definitely got something to do with the
weather conditions and humidity.

I just printed a letter I prepared using Latex, onto Conqueror paper,
and it looks every bit as good as laser output.

Conclusion:-
If you live in a warm, dry climate, go for a laser printer every time.
If you live in a cooler, more damp climate, an inkjet is OK especially
if a photo quality unit is required, and you can't get to a shop to have
photos properly printed onto photo paper.
